Vladimir Ivanov was a Soviet politician active in the political structures of the early Soviet state. He served during a period of significant political change and consolidation of Soviet power, contributing to the administrative and political development of the Soviet system.
Ivanov fell victim to the Great Purge, a campaign of political repression that claimed countless lives among the Soviet leadership and intelligentsia. He was executed at the Kommunarka shooting ground in 1938, becoming one of many politicians eliminated during this period of terror.
